Definition of duty of tonnage

Definition: A charge imposed on a commercial vessel for entering, remaining in, or leaving a port, usually assessed on the basis of the ship's weight.

Example: A cargo ship weighing 10,000 tons enters a port and is charged a duty of $10 per ton. The duty of tonnage for this ship would be $100,000.

This example illustrates how the duty of tonnage is calculated based on the weight of the ship. It is a tax imposed on commercial vessels for using a port's facilities. The duty of tonnage is a source of revenue for the government and helps to maintain the port's infrastructure.

Simple Definition

Duty is something that you have to do because it is your responsibility or because someone else has a right to expect it from you. It can be a legal obligation or a moral one. There are different types of duties, such as active duty, passive duty, contractual duty, and fiduciary duty. Duty can also refer to a tax or charge imposed on goods or transactions, such as import duty or tonnage duty.
